Modifying population mortality/morbidity tables for sub-population experience

20 Views Asked by At

I have a population morbidity table that shows proportion of people expected to become sick by age, gender, smoker-status etc. Let's call this population-P1.

I also have sample data of sickness incidence from a sub-population of population-P1. Let's call this population-P2.

It is not known if population-P2 has the same or different morbidity as population-P1.

Is there an R package (or package in an alternative language) that modifies the morbidity table associated with population-P1 in light of the data from population-P2 to give a morbidity table for population-P2?
